Historians generally recognize three motives for European exploration and colonization in the New World: God, gold, and glory.

Indirect rule was a system where colonial powers used traditional rulers (nchiefso) as the local level of government, empowering them to tax, dispense law and maintain order.

European nations began to search for new overseas colonies after 1880 to... Obtain raw materials for industries and open new markets for products. Why did Europeans want to colonize west Africa? West Africa had many useful raw materials.

How did Western imperialism change after 1880? New imperialism was characterized by a frantic rush to plant the flag as quickly as possible along as much territory as possible, leading in disastrous results in comparison of carefully drawn out negotiative and strategic colonization.

After 1880, European nations sought colonies in Africa primarily because the Europeans were. competing for raw materials and markets. Which statement best reflects the effect of imperialism in Africa? Natural resources were exploited for the benefit of European powers.

Because the Industrial Revolution increased the production capacity of Western states astronomically, there was an enormous hunger for raw materials to satisfy demands. Thus, the Western powers sought colonies where raw materials were abundant and where they could be appropriated at little to no cost.
